New issue
Advanced search Search tips

Issue 867594 link

Starred by 1 user

Issue metadata

Status: Assigned
Owner:
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 3
Type: Bug



Sign in to add a comment

Improve readability of viz::Display and viz::DisplayScheduler

Project Member Reported by samans@chromium.org, Jul 25

Issue description

Improve readability of viz::Display and viz::DisplayScheduler and along the way figure out what the hell is going on in these classes.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Jul 26

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/0f0e3789b9d004c75fad28beaf478020ef2e0440

commit 0f0e3789b9d004c75fad28beaf478020ef2e0440
Author: Saman Sami <samans@chromium.org>
Date: Thu Jul 26 00:20:20 2018

Rename DisplayScheduler::SetRootSurfaceResourcesLocked

It just means root surface doesn't exist or doesn't have an active frame
so update the naming.

Bug: 867594
Cq-Include-Trybots: luci.chromium.try:android_optional_gpu_tests_rel
Change-Id: I42a4b5db05ef8168c31f6a2fd9b9694b8cf5200c
Reviewed-on: https://chromium-review.googlesource.com/1150613
Reviewed-by: Fady Samuel <fsamuel@chromium.org>
Commit-Queue: Saman Sami <samans@chromium.org>
Cr-Commit-Position: refs/heads/master@{#578139}
[modify] https://crrev.com/0f0e3789b9d004c75fad28beaf478020ef2e0440/components/viz/service/display/display.cc
[modify] https://crrev.com/0f0e3789b9d004c75fad28beaf478020ef2e0440/components/viz/service/display/display.h
[modify] https://crrev.com/0f0e3789b9d004c75fad28beaf478020ef2e0440/components/viz/service/display/display_scheduler.cc
[modify] https://crrev.com/0f0e3789b9d004c75fad28beaf478020ef2e0440/components/viz/service/display/display_scheduler.h
[modify] https://crrev.com/0f0e3789b9d004c75fad28beaf478020ef2e0440/components/viz/service/display/display_scheduler_unittest.cc

Cc: rjkroege@chromium.org kylec...@chromium.org sadrul@chromium.org enne@chromium.org
Project Member

Comment 3 by bugdroid1@chromium.org, Jul 26

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/47f3e1c1640b4f49585850af36347a4ad290a7e8

commit 47f3e1c1640b4f49585850af36347a4ad290a7e8
Author: Saman Sami <samans@chromium.org>
Date: Thu Jul 26 21:15:42 2018

Add comments for BeginFrameDeadlineMode

Bug: 867594
Cq-Include-Trybots: luci.chromium.try:android_optional_gpu_tests_rel
Change-Id: I6e3b94e187996b7b153932041074704bd2fb5895
Reviewed-on: https://chromium-review.googlesource.com/1150805
Reviewed-by: Fady Samuel <fsamuel@chromium.org>
Commit-Queue: Saman Sami <samans@chromium.org>
Cr-Commit-Position: refs/heads/master@{#578442}
[modify] https://crrev.com/47f3e1c1640b4f49585850af36347a4ad290a7e8/components/viz/service/display/display_scheduler.h

Sign in to add a comment